Hodgkiss Bequest Will Endow Chair Created In Civil Engineering

Over many years, Donald and Nancy Hodgkiss have supported MSU in a variety of significant ways. Recently, they established an endowed chair in civil engineering via a charitable bequest of remaining retirement plan assets. It will be called The Donald and Nancy A. Hodgkiss Endowed Chair in Civil Engineering, and it is yet another meaningful manifestation of their enduring commitment to their alma mater.

The Hodgkiss fund is a substantial commitment to the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ering. Don (Engineering, '49) and Nancy (Education, '52) hope that the endowed chair might specifically focus on road and airport design and construction, but they have also stipulated that the endowment will be available for other areas of need related to civil engineering, providing the college with the greatest flexibility possible.

As Don and Nancy contemplated their future gift, they learned that the greatest need within the Department of Civil & Environmental Engineering was endowed chairs. They also found that remaining retirement plan funds would be the most efficient asset that would enable them to remember the department in the manner they desired. Their gift will support a faculty position that focuses on civil infrastructure.

Because the fund is endowed, the principal will remain intact. Each year, only a portion of the available interest earned will be used to support the Hodgkiss Chair, while the remainder will be reserved and reinvested to grow the principal investment of the fund.
